Two Non-Pro Futurity classes, one class for Weanling Fillies and one for Weanling Colts/Geldings will be offered. Entries must be registered with APHA but can be sired by any stallion. Owners and exhibitors must be current WCHA and APHA members to compete; memberships can be purchased when entering your horses. The champion of each class will win a beautiful silver show halter provided by Kathy’s Show Equipment. In addition to 100% of entry fees going back into the purse, an added $1,000 for each class will be up for grabs.
